Monacor SP-302C
Thiele-Small parameters
| Nominal size | 12" |
|---|---|
| Impedance | 4 Ω |
| Fs | 33 Hz |
| Qts | 0.607 |
| Qes | 0.71 |
| Qms | 4.19 |
| Vas | 155 L |
| Sd | 531 cm² |
| Xmax | 5 mm |
| Re | 3.7 Ω |
| Bl | 8 T·m |
| Mms | 59.3 g |
| Pe | 150 W |
| Sensitivity | 94.3 dB |
Alignment hint
| EBP | 46 · sealed |
|---|---|
| Sealed Vb (Qtc ≈ 0.71) | ≈ 434.1 L |
EBP < 50: favours a sealed (closed) alignment.
Rules of thumb from T/S parameters only. Verify against a real simulation before cutting wood.
